With A Smile And A Song presents 30 examples of Doris Day during her popular peak, which is the dozen-year period from the early ‘50s to the mid-’60s, when she was lighting up the silver screen as well as the charts.
Ms. Doris Day helped with the compilation of With A Smile And A Song and included her classic hits “Whatever Will Be, Will Be (Que Sera, Sera),” “Pillow Talk,” “Secret Love,” and “By the Light of the Silv'ry Moon.”
Unlike previous compilations, With A Smile And A Song focuses on her great vocal standards: “You Go to My Head,” “My Romance,” “Fools Rush In,” “But Beautiful,” “Our Love Is Here to Stay,” “Love Me or Leave Me,” and “It Had to Be You.” It shows how Doris Day became one of the best and best-loved vocalists of the 20th century.
